 Compact, integrated electron beam imaging system

An electron beam imaging system is described wherein a sharp-tip electron source is biased to produce an electron flow and a conductive target is placed in the path of the electron flow. A planar, electrostatic lens is positioned in the electron flow path and between the electron source and target. The lens includes an aperture; at least a first conductive plane that is biased less negative than the electron source; and one or more conductive planes separated by dielectric layers. A secondary electron detector is formed on the surface of the electrostatic lens that is closest to the conductive target, whereby the lens may be positioned close to the target and still not obstruct secondary electrons emitted from the target from impinging on the secondary electron detector.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Referring now to FIG.
1, an electron beam imaging system constructed in accordance with the invention comprises a sharp tip electron source 10, a planar electrostatic lens 12, a substrate 14 and a stage 16 which may, for instance, be a known PZT actuator.
Electron source 10 is provided with a tip 18 that has a voltage -V1 applied which enables it to operate in the field emission mode.
Electrostatic lens 12 comprises a conductive sheet 20 and a juxtaposed dielectric layer 22.
An annular ring of conductor 24 is emplaced on the lower surface of dielectric layer 22 and about an aperture 25 that passes through each of the aforesaid layers.
Potential sources V2 and V3 are respectively connected to conductors 20 and 24 so as to create an electrostatic focusing action on the emitted electrons from tip 18.
To extract electrons into free space, the electrons must experience an overall accelerating voltage.
In this case, that implies V3-(-V1)>0.
In the case of three or more conducting layers, the condition is that Vf-(-V1)>0, where Vf is the voltage on the electrode closest to the sample.
In the case shown here, the potential difference V3-(-V1)) is generally greater than the difference (V2-(-V1)) in order to achieve focusing action.
Generally the target will be held at potential V3, so that no electric field exists in the free space region between the lens and the target.
It is possible, however, to place a different bias voltage on the target, in which case the target can be considered as part of the lens and can provide additional electrostatic focusing.
Alternatively, the target may be held at a potential which is slightly negative with respect to the secondary detector in order to enhance the collection of the secondary electrons.
As a result of the focusing action of microlens 12, emitted electrons from tip 18 are focused onto a conductive surface 26 of sample 14 and cause secondary electrons to be emitted therefrom.
